Description
Southern Plains Beaded Hide Strike-a-Light Bag
fourth quarter 19th century
possibly Comanche, sinew-sewn thick hide and beaded using colors white, red white-heart, dark blue, black, greasy yellow, pink, and pea green; further embellished with tin cone fringe and an 1838 Liberty Head Large Cent coin
overall length 7 inches
An argument rages among the experts about how to differentiate between the work of these two [Kiowa and Comanche] tribes. Â The Comanche seem to have preferred white or green backgrounds and simpler designs. Â With strike-a-light bags, they may have continued to use the older, rectangular shape into the twentieth century. Â However, intermarriage and constant interchange of designs and artifacts have rendered differentiation nearly impossible, unless tribal origin was carefully documented at the time the object was acquired (Hanson 1994: 89).
Published:
Spirits in the Art (Hanson 1994: 89, plate 95)
